修复ChatGPT安装包签名冲突的步骤详解

  chatgpt文章  2025-07-10 09:35      本文共包含1016个文字,预计阅读时间3分钟

在安装或更新ChatGPT应用程序时,用户偶尔会遇到签名冲突的问题,这通常表现为安装失败或系统警告提示。签名冲突主要发生在应用程序的数字签名与系统预期不符的情况下,可能由多种原因引起,包括版本不一致、签名证书变更或系统安全设置冲突等。理解并解决这一问题对于确保ChatGPT应用程序正常运行至关重要。

签名冲突原因分析

签名冲突的根本原因在于应用程序的数字签名验证失败。数字签名是开发者用来证明应用程序真实性和完整性的加密标记,操作系统通过验证签名来确认应用程序未被篡改。当系统检测到签名与预期不符时,会阻止安装或运行以保护用户安全。

这种情况可能发生在ChatGPT更新过程中,特别是当用户从非官方渠道获取安装包时。不同来源的安装包可能使用不同的签名证书,导致系统无法识别。系统时间设置错误也可能干扰签名验证过程,因为数字签名通常具有有效期限制。

彻底卸载旧版本

解决签名冲突的第一步是彻底清除设备上的旧版本ChatGPT。简单的应用卸载可能无法完全删除所有相关文件和注册表项,这些残留可能导致新版本安装时出现冲突。使用专业的卸载工具或手动清理系统目录可以确保彻底移除。

在Windows系统中,可通过控制面板的"程序和功能"进行卸载,然后手动删除AppData和ProgramData目录下的相关文件夹。对于macOS用户,除了将应用拖入废纸篓外,还需要清理~/Library和/Library中的偏好设置和支持文件。Android设备可通过设置中的应用管理完成卸载,iOS则需要长按图标选择删除。

获取官方安装包

确保从OpenAI官方网站或授权的应用商店下载最新版本的ChatGPT安装包至关重要。第三方网站提供的安装包可能被修改过,或者使用不同的签名证书,这直接导致签名验证失败。官方渠道始终是获取安全可靠软件的唯一途径。

下载前应核对文件哈希值与官方公布的值是否一致,这可以验证文件完整性。注意检查下载页面的URL是否正确,防止钓鱼网站。对于移动设备用户,建议仅通过Google Play Store或Apple App Store安装,这些平台会自动验证应用签名。

调整系统安全设置

某些严格的安全设置可能过度拦截合法的应用程序安装。在Windows中,可以临时调整用户账户控制(UAC)级别或禁用SmartScreen筛选器。macOS用户可能需要修改Gatekeeper设置,允许安装来自"任何来源"的应用,但完成后应恢复默认安全级别。

对于企业环境或教育机构的设备,组策略或移动设备管理(MDM)配置可能限制非标准应用的安装。这种情况下,需要联系IT管理员获取安装权限或请求将ChatGPT加入白名单。临时禁用防病毒软件也可能有助于解决签名验证问题,但需谨慎操作并尽快重新启用保护。

证书管理策略

高级用户可考虑管理系统的证书存储。Windows的证书管理器允许查看和修改受信任的根证书,而macOS的钥匙串访问工具提供类似功能。非专业用户不建议直接操作系统证书设置,错误的修改可能导致更广泛的安全问题。

如果确认是证书问题导致签名冲突,可以尝试导出新版本ChatGPT的签名证书并手动添加到系统的受信任列表。这种方法需要精确的技术操作,仅适用于熟悉公钥基础设施(PKI)的用户。大多数情况下,重新下载官方安装包是更安全简单的解决方案。

系统时间同步检查

数字签名验证依赖于准确的时间戳,系统时间错误会导致签名显示为"过期"或"尚未生效"。确保设备时钟与互联网时间服务器同步,时区和日期格式设置也应正确。这在虚拟机或长期未联网的设备上尤为常见。

Windows用户可通过"日期和时间设置"中的"同步时钟"功能校正时间。macOS和Linux系统通常自动同步时间,但可手动检查ntpd服务状态。移动设备同样需要确保自动日期和时间设置已启用,特别是跨越时区旅行后。

 

 相关推荐

推荐文章
热门文章
推荐标签